Answer:

The nth term is 4n+2

Explanation:

Formula:

term to term difference x n +/- term before first term

The term to term difference = +4

so 4n

Next, find the term before the first term

the first term in the sequence is 6, in order to find the term before 6 you must inverse the term to term difference

+4 becomes -4

6 - 4 = 2

In this sequence, the term before the first term (6) is +2

add the term before the first term to the term to term difference

4n + 2
